Michael Richard Marquette Michael Richard Marquette from Hernando Florida wrote on February 14, 2026 at 1:48 pm
I was there when Tom discharged the firearm at friendship and they kicked him out so he decided to buy the place across the creek my dad who was his best friend Richard Lee Marquette were there from the beginning it was a mud hole. Tom my dad and the rest of the guys would play poker in the old house on the hill and the big fire pit outside where everybody used to sit and b*******. We had a signal cannon from the 7th Cavalry which we fired into the side of the Hill. I'm sure friendship regrets kicking Tom out when I was a little boy I would say Mr Kerr and he would say call me Tom I knew him long before they got friendship. We dress in our uniforms because Tom had hundreds I worked in the concessions for him and he paid me off with uniforms so I could dress up never forget it. My father was abusive and when we were at Tom and Rosemary's house shooting off fireworks Tom had bought a whole fireworks Factory more fireworks than I'd ever seen in my life am I excitement I somehow angered my father tried to hit me and rosemary stepped in front of him and let him know he would not be walking very well if he touch me. Putting him in this place immediately. In those days women didn't stand up like that and I always admired her for that and never forgot it it always wanted to thank her. She was not intimidated by men like most women. But they were both so nice to me all the time as a child fantastic memories I will never lose
